Ukraine Tests Homegrown Long-Range Flamingo Missile
"There were successful tests of this missile. So far, the missile is the most successful we have -- it flies 3,000 km, this is important," Zelensky emphasized, underscoring the significance of the missile’s extended range capability.
The president further revealed that Ukraine anticipates receiving additional missiles by December of this year. Plans are already underway for mass production of the Flamingo missile to commence by February 2026, marking a critical step in boosting the country’s defense capabilities amid ongoing regional tensions.
